在云计算渗透到各行各业的当下,云服务器已成为企业业务运行的数字基石。随着应用迭代频率的提升,如何高效处理系统故障、迁移需求及性能优化等场景,正逐步成为运维人员的关键技能。本文将深入解析云服务器重做系统的全流程,并提供实用建议。
当服务器出现系统文件损坏、服务响应异常或兼容性问题时,常规的修复手段往往难以彻底解决问题。例如数据库服务频繁崩溃可能导致业务中断,此时重装系统可快速恢复服务稳定性。
随着容器化部署和微服务架构的普及,传统单机部署逐渐被虚拟化解决方案取代。通过重装系统部署Kubernetes集群,可构建弹性伸缩的业务架构,这在电商、金融等高频交易场景中尤为常见。
面对勒索软件威胁加剧的现状,定期实施系统重装配合补丁更新,已成为防御APT攻击的有效手段。某跨国企业在遭受0day漏洞攻击后,通过系统重装与数据快照恢复,将业务中断时间控制在30分钟以内。
避免盲目使用默认镜像,建议:
Web应用重装后需重新配置反向代理规则,某游戏平台曾因Nginx配置缺失导致登录接口异常。建议建立配置版本库,通过Git管理变更记录。
重新分配磁盘空间时,需注意以下限制:
使用Ansible自动部署脚本时,应建立多分支配置管理:
# 示例命令
ansible-playbook deploy/main.yml -t web-server -e "release_version=2.3.1"
配合Jenkins流水线实现代码的灰度发布,避免单点故障导致服务中断。
建立三角色分级策略:
将重复性操作封装为函数库模块,例如:
def server_reinstall(vid, snapshot_id):
if CheckDiskHealth(vid) and ValidateSnapshot(snapshot_id):
Init reinstall Workflow
else:
Send alert to ops team
确保关键操作具备可回溯日志记录功能。
强制实施以下安全策略:
| 场景类型 | 处理时长 | 效果评估 | 成本开销 |
|---|---|---|---|
| 漏洞修复 | 30-60min | 消除安全隐忧 | 低(仅耗时) |
| 架构升级 | 2-4h | 增强系统弹性 | 中(新组件部署) |
| 灾容恢复 | 1h内 | 业务零丢失 | 高(增量备份带宽) |
某在线教育平台通过建立"预装系统镜像库",在课程审核系统升级时实现5分钟级服务切换。
云服务器系统的重装不仅是技术操作,更是业务连续性保障的关键环节。通过标准化流程设计、工具链建设及风险管理,运维团队可将这项工作转化为敏捷的支撑手段。建议制定包含7个关键质量点(KQPs)的实施手册,并定期开展红蓝对抗演练,持续提升系统韧性。在数字化转型加速的当下,这将成为企业构建核心竞争力的必要能力。